[jboss-svn-commits] JBL Code SVN: r5965 - labs/jbossrules/branches/3.0.x/drools-core/src/main/java/org/drools/reteoo
jboss-svn-commits at lists.jboss.org
jboss-svn-commits at lists.jboss.org
Wed Aug 23 12:23:52 EDT 2006
Author: mark.proctor at jboss.com
Date: 2006-08-23 12:23:51 -0400 (Wed, 23 Aug 2006)
New Revision: 5965
Modified:
labs/jbossrules/branches/3.0.x/drools-core/src/main/java/org/drools/reteoo/ReteooBuilder.java
Log:
JBRULES-410 More than one Query definition causes an incorrect Rete network to be built
-The attachQuery method now correctly uses attachNode.
-DroolsQuery now implements hashcode and equals methods.
Modified: labs/jbossrules/branches/3.0.x/drools-core/src/main/java/org/drools/reteoo/ReteooBuilder.java
===================================================================
--- labs/jbossrules/branches/3.0.x/drools-core/src/main/java/org/drools/reteoo/ReteooBuilder.java 2006-08-23 16:23:23 UTC (rev 5964)
+++ labs/jbossrules/branches/3.0.x/drools-core/src/main/java/org/drools/reteoo/ReteooBuilder.java 2006-08-23 16:23:51 UTC (rev 5965)
@@ -335,14 +335,6 @@
// first column
this.currentOffsetAdjustment += 1;
- // final ObjectSource objectSource = attachNode( new ObjectTypeNode( this.id++,
- // this.sinklistFactory.newObjectSinkList( ObjectTypeNode.class ),
- // new ClassObjectType( InitialFact.class ),
- // this.rete ) );
- //
- // this.tupleSource = attachNode( new LeftInputAdapterNode( this.id++,
- // objectSource ) );
-
final ObjectSource objectTypeSource = attachNode( new ObjectTypeNode( this.id++,
this.sinklistFactory.newObjectSinkList( ObjectTypeNode.class ),
new ClassObjectType( DroolsQuery.class ),
More information about the jboss-svn-commits
mailing list